What is major disadvantage of neural network?

Arguably, the best-known disadvantage of neural networks is their “black box” nature . Simply put, you don’t know how or why your NN came up with a certain output.

What is the disadvantage of neural network?

Disadvantages include its “black box” nature, greater computational burden, proneness to overfitting, and the empirical nature of model development . What is the biggest advantage of deep learning?

One of deep learning’s main advantages over other machine learning algorithms is its capacity to execute feature engineering on it own . A deep learning algorithm will scan the data to search for features that correlate and combine them to enable faster learning without being explicitly told to do so.

Is Neural Network difficult?

Training deep learning neural networks is very challenging . The best general algorithm known for solving this problem is stochastic gradient descent, where model weights are updated each iteration using the backpropagation of error algorithm. Optimization in general is an extremely difficult task.

How accurate are neural networks?

A survey of 96 studies comparing the performance between neural networks and statistical regression models in several fields, showed that neural networks outperformed the regression models in about 58% of the cases , whereas in 24% of the cases, the performance of the statistical models were equivalent to the neural ...

Why is CNN better than MLP?

Both MLP and CNN can be used for Image classification however MLP takes vector as input and CNN takes tensor as input so CNN can understand spatial relation(relation between nearby pixels of image)between pixels of images better thus for complicated images CNN will perform better than MLP.
